- What is the Nft smart contract?
- How are nft and smart contracts connected?
- Here are the leading roles of a smart contract nft
- How is NFT smart contract created?
- What Smart Contracts cover
An NFT smart contract is critical to the functioning of digital artworks. Artistic, intellectual properties called non-fungible tokens have become trendy and attracted multiple players. The popularity of NFTs has caught the attention of celebrities, athletes, and creatives. These famous individuals are commercializing their NFTs by signing smart contract nft with NFT developers or minters. Here, we explore why an Nft smart contract is vital when creating digital collectibles.
What is the Nft smart contract?
First, you need to understand what an NFT is before elaborating on the NFT smart contract. NFT is a one-of-a-kind token that’s scarce and proves your ownership of a digital asset. An NFT has two critical attributes that make it unique: fungibility and scarcity.
Fungibility is the capacity of an asset to be traded for another with a similar type. For example, a $10 bill is fungible with any other $10 bill. However, the Oppenheimer Diamond, for instance, is non-fungible. This means that no other similar version of Oppenheimer Diamond exists.
Now that you’ve known what an NFT is, let’s explain what a smart contract nft is. An Nft smart contract is a virtual agreement where the contract terms between parties are created in a code. The contract is self-executing once the predetermined conditions are met. Developers create nft smart contract on decentralized ledger networks.
Digital collectibles enable scarcity. Although some information from NFT can be reproduced and distributed, the certificate of authenticity and legal rights will stay on one immutable NFT. Digital collectibles reside on a decentralized ledger like Ethereum and offer a certificate of authenticity.
As the popularity of NFT keeps rising, many developers are at the advanced stages of creating an nft minting contract that can hold up in a legal court. An Nft smart contract can be developed to activate other digital agreements or create new events once they’re accomplished.
Besides holding NFTs, smart nft token can be developed to carry assets. As explained by the contractual code, these assets can be shared once the predetermined agreements are fulfilled.
How are nft and smart contracts connected?
NFT’s and smart contracts need each other. NFTs are powered by digital agreements which direct their multiple actions, such as:
- Checking ownership
- Handling transferability
- Linking to other virtual assets
- Handling royalty compensations
Here are the leading roles of a smart contract nft
Permanent identification data
The Nft smart contract makes it possible to have permanent identification data. While in the market, the nft marketplace smart contract makes it impossible for further division of NFTs.
Smart contracts maintain the scarcity of an NFT.
One of the attributes of NFTs is that they’re scarce. This scarcity can only be possible through an Nft smart contract. With this scarcity, your digital artworks will maintain their value.
Verification that the terms of the agreements are met
A smart contract performs the role of an intermediary. The digital code ensures that the agreement terms between the owner and buyer are met. Once the two parties fulfill the predetermined conditions, smart contracts automatically execute them.
Nft smart contract contains vital information about the artwork
While creating an nft minting contract, the creator captures essential data regarding the NFT. Some of the data to expect include the name of the artist, other participants entitled to royalties, and the ownership track record of the digital artwork.
How is NFT smart contract created?
The process of making an NFT is known as minting. NFT minting contract entails writing the underlying agreement code. The digital agreement code determines the attributes of the NFT and attaches them to the relevant decentralized ledger. This is the network on which the specific NFT is coded. Multiple standards have been formed for developing NFTs. Here are the primary standards for nft smart contract:
- ERC 721 Standard: This is the most common standard many developers use. It’s an open standard that explains how to create digital collectibles on the Ethereum network. It’s a unique standard that defines the role of a smart contract. Through ERC 721, when a smart nft token is sent, you need the following data: smart contract address and token ID.
- ERC 1155 Standard: This multi-token standard lets each coin ID represent its changeable token form. The token has its unique qualities and supplies information.
- Flow NFT Standard: This standard enables the creation of an Nft smart contract in Cadence- a language applicable in Flow. A smart nft token on Flow is upgradeable. The digital agreement can be launched in a beta state and gradually upgraded by the initial writer.
- FA2 Standard: F2A standard is also called TZIP-12. This is the best standard for developers who want to create nft smart contract supporting an array of tokens. Some of the tickets that FA2 standard supports include fungible, non-fungible, and non-transferable.
What Smart Contracts cover
A smart contract nft can capture various things, including the fundamental rights that are being traded. Most people mistakenly think that if you own an asset, its copyright belongs to you too. What you should understand is that Ownership and Copyright are different. In most cases, the copyright belongs to the authors of the work.
The nft marketplace smart contract highlights the specific rights to the buyer. Nft smart contract states that digital collectibles are separate from art.
Typically, the approval allows the buyer to showcase the NFT artwork. The license would also approve of creating products that integrate the art. However, these terms may differ from each transaction. And that’s why they’re coded in an Nft smart contract.
A vital component of an NFT is a smart contract. AN nft marketplace smart contract is a digital agreement with the terms and conditions in a code. A smart contract is self-executing when the parties meet all the terms and conditions. Here, we’ve explored the critical functions of smart contracts within the NFT context. From keeping vital information to verifying the terms of agreements, smart contracts are essential in the blockchain ecosystem.